How To Get Glass Out Of Feet?

Wash your hands and the foot with soap and water

Sit in a well-lit area

Rinse the foot with clean water

If the glass is visible and sticking out, use clean tweezers to remove it gently

If the glass is embedded, do not dig into the skin

Apply gentle pressure around the area if it is bleeding

Use adhesive tape to lift out tiny surface shards

Soak the foot in warm water for 10 to 15 minutes if needed to loosen the skin

Clean the area again after removal

Apply antiseptic or antibiotic ointment

Cover with a clean bandage

Watch for redness, swelling, pus, increasing pain, or fever

Get medical help if the glass is deep, cannot be removed, bleeding will not stop, or you cannot walk

Get medical help if you have diabetes, poor circulation, or a weakened immune system

Seek urgent care if numbness, severe pain, or a large wound is present
